72 Deepdene, Potters Bar, EN6 3DE is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 980 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£608,952 , which equates to approximately £622 per square foot. It was last sold on 19 Dec 2022 for £612,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£3,048, representing a 0.5% decrease, or approximately 0.2% per year.

72 Deepdene, Potters Bar, Hertsmere, Hertfordshire, EN6 3DE has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 10 Mar 2022.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 16 Oct 2013,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 67.4%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inder thermostat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 75 mm loft insulation to pitched, 100 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(average).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, improving energy efficiency from poor to average.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 20%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
